# Ashbourne (DE6) Market Overview Ashbourne's property market has demonstrated moderate resilience over the past five years, with prices appreciating at a 3.5% compound annual growth rate while rental values expanded more substantially at 5.5% annually. The district scores 52.2/100 on trajectory metrics, placing it in the 63rd percentile nationally and indicating strong fundamentals relative to broader UK benchmarks. Population growth remains constrained at 0.1% over five years, suggesting limited demographic expansion despite the rental yield advantage. The market currently sits at a latent gentrification stage, indicating early-stage development characteristics without established transformation patterns. These dynamics suggest Ashbourne represents a stable rental market with modest capital appreciation potential.

What is the average house price in Ashbourne?
The average property price in Ashbourne (DE6) is £202k as of January 2026, based on UK House Price Index data. Prices have grown at 2.8% per year over the last five years.
What is the average rent in Ashbourne?
The median monthly rent in Ashbourne (DE6) is £696 (2026), based on ONS private rental data.
